Received: by 2002:a05:6a10:f347:0:0:0:0 with SMTP id d7csp2808927pxu; Mon, 7 Dec 2020 16:50:46 -0800 (PST) X-Google-Smtp-Source: ABdhPJzlNYYvcDHK52peFSqauRwSsDCJ9JtMAIhIM2I8lPiGMme+/KUDC0r8fjEPSfTlVnWRdjhX X-Received: by 2002:a17:906:a00a:: with SMTP id p10mr8741375ejy.312.1607388646599; Mon, 07 Dec 2020 16:50:46 -0800 (PST) ARC-Seal: i=1; a=rsa-sha256; t=1607388646; cv=none; d=google.com; s=arc-20160816; b=XqUIavc7Ku9JQh7jVyKFrNuG50quD1hn/8OAl2ps6qj8F0C0J0iOV0pPo9yS2MhplH dw7w8Sacg6QvxOtILefFsJ8oDRi1mf4FF6/hXS3i4hkxQjsdWhAlDAFtMqYJP/dIBNl9 9JP/QjqnT3MiYyADY7coqlN/BGd03TCVMj8cAV0W7Ovrb/dzYnaoU8zVcA1qEH2Fl9sk git1sWrYXyFuHC+o0ZgWTXadSAaMDkPIOImiNICVfRoKky3nryXUis879IM8iSK/0Hxr iyBCjp5GMYAsDYox6rWm1WaJWktFC0i1sRU1ajVmGKhKggyugm9gMKict/7wLPd0Lsf+ 8apA==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=list-id:precedence:cc:to:subject:message-id:date:from:in-reply-to :references:mime-version:dkim-signature; bh=upb/CqjljGMq0mDhDOTo+ddS28Jk9ogwKt4euX8NQs4=; b=le9qG7TUbiTB17IzyyQwR3OZOh3WfAa2CzTWb3byg1+4TovVvKuzH7pD1DvS3s6Ldr pSMSzsPvA7Y/Wx8XKr+D4Y+4pBNYBq/o30ToRr0u9GDXTAb4pBXrBXxxFY4ZOg9U8dL8 mgoV3yHxL3jfHF+ZMLG7LGbHSlLJ+oqcdHQ6p4JQb4sJBtm2jD7cMVTInlVyel6K+DFZ r6+iIFsaX7Ki1hcZLrjLvg5YjfawL1V4YAGlZGNqRbIhVCFr2h/co9E3+yyJwtRUALkC BPVu+ptd7fGYcspzMbFdTIrmGHZkLBKeFsivicSMOb+rWLi00+nxtfKIy31iY9Ii6oyi V/Zw== ARC-Authentication-Results: i=1; mx.google.com; dkim=pass header.i=@chromium.org header.s=google header.b=FL1MkXJu; spf=pass (google.com: domain of linux-wireless-owner@vger.kernel.org designates 23.128.96.18 as permitted sender) smtp.mailfrom=linux-wireless-owner@vger.kernel.org; dmarc=pass (p=NONE sp=NONE dis=NONE) header.from=chromium.org Return-Path: Received: from vger.kernel.org (vger.kernel.org. [23.128.96.18]) by mx.google.com with ESMTP id v3si7441377ejx.433.2020.12.07.16.50.11; Mon, 07 Dec 2020 16:50:46 -0800 (PST) Received-SPF: pass (google.com: domain of linux-wireless-owner@vger.kernel.org designates 23.128.96.18 as permitted sender) client-ip=23.128.96.18; Authentication-Results: mx.google.com; dkim=pass header.i=@chromium.org header.s=google header.b=FL1MkXJu; spf=pass (google.com: domain of linux-wireless-owner@vger.kernel.org designates 23.128.96.18 as permitted sender) smtp.mailfrom=linux-wireless-owner@vger.kernel.org; dmarc=pass (p=NONE sp=NONE dis=NONE) header.from=chromium.org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1728512AbgLHADZ (ORCPT + 99 others); Mon, 7 Dec 2020 19:03:25 -0500 Received: from lindbergh.monkeyblade.net ([23.128.96.19]:45076 "EHLO lindbergh.monkeyblade.net"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1727062AbgLHADY (ORCPT ); Mon, 7 Dec 2020 19:03:24 -0500 Received: from mail-ua1-x942.google.com (mail-ua1-x942.google.com [IPv6:2607:f8b0:4864:20::942]) by lindbergh.monkeyblade.net (Postfix) with ESMTPS id 7D33EC061285 for ; Mon, 7 Dec 2020 16:02:36 -0800 (PST) Received: by mail-ua1-x942.google.com with SMTP id x13so5092497uar.4 for ; Mon, 07 Dec 2020 16:02:36 -0800 (PST)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=chromium.org; s=google; h=mime-version:references:in-reply-to:from:date:message-id:subject:to :cc; bh=upb/CqjljGMq0mDhDOTo+ddS28Jk9ogwKt4euX8NQs4=; b=FL1MkXJu3M0BAsQbDDwOhOO07lK8vxkNwD3gVvvAFsHzWvAVD4uVocaZxFmag3g/mB 7wb405alpjK9lwL5NGrDPVV8pPeW0G/kivR+vySa+9Yh+v7vqyALp0zMV8t8RdWciWxT Wgy9Q4cy1HuJdqY5aJDn0xcqqodUnwgQ+cBYA= X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20161025; h=x-gm-message-state:mime-version:references:in-reply-to:from:date :message-id:subject:to:cc; bh=upb/CqjljGMq0mDhDOTo+ddS28Jk9ogwKt4euX8NQs4=; b=LcMNSc7faNR+/CKpxr/yG5oBWk97DFOhLm+zh3KvfkjMNdOpUKL7t7BYgV/kD5FE1O TKj5f5Z6Shgwjdx76yagjoEII30YhqaQzEi5vcopdl/qvikuxAfncYOOIvWyIVEyuc/Z /lqZxQ8a1eOqD0JMZya6Qs86sHcj9UEgmvT8t91hyaFHEJFFfbF2f2sqVsw+V9MpFuJV 894l40tt0HU6dupNIx4cSfDDuLGWLx/W0jh469k02BzE8zM3dCaraCBUc3D6Y4OBUkGx z5yIUebJiR52BKXTnYynW79l5kpooN9cqgYGpOCVCQZhZMmDAFq65Df3IJrnTeRe7AvU zn1g== X-Gm-Message-State: AOAM533Tre7pUBt5zTQQ5ol/Nl4bT3TGk/64B2mXI2DyyOOkd3Isox/U KncF3r4QfMGN/rRbokFwzB3uTdKHYKYgVQ== X-Received: by 2002:a9f:2191:: with SMTP id 17mr13806076uac.83.1607385755296; Mon, 07 Dec 2020 16:02:35 -0800 (PST) Received: from mail-ua1-f44.google.com (mail-ua1-f44.google.com. [209.85.222.44]) by smtp.gmail.com with ESMTPSA id b81sm1894651vka.53.2020.12.07.16.02.34 for (version=TLS1_3 cipher=TLS_AES_128_GCM_SHA256 bits=128/128); Mon, 07 Dec 2020 16:02:34 -0800 (PST) Received: by mail-ua1-f44.google.com with SMTP id y26so5093315uan.5 for ; Mon, 07 Dec 2020 16:02:34 -0800 (PST) X-Received: by 2002:ab0:35fa:: with SMTP id w26mr13479881uau.90.1607385753680; Mon, 07 Dec 2020 16:02:33 -0800 (PST) MIME-Version: 1.0 References: <20201207231824.v3.1.Ia6b95087ca566f77423f3802a78b946f7b593ff5@changeid> In-Reply-To: <20201207231824.v3.1.Ia6b95087ca566f77423f3802a78b946f7b593ff5@changeid> From: Doug Anderson Date: Mon, 7 Dec 2020 16:02:20 -0800 X-Gmail-Original-Message-ID: Message-ID: Subject: Re: [PATCH v3] ath10k: add option for chip-id based BDF selection To: Abhishek Kumar Cc: Kalle Valo , LKML , linux-wireless , ath10k , Rakesh Pillai , Brian Norris , "David S. Miller" , Jakub Kicinski , netdev Content-Type: text/plain; charset="UTF-8" Precedence: bulk List-ID: X-Mailing-List: linux-wireless@vger.kernel.org Hi, On Mon, Dec 7, 2020 at 3:23 PM Abhishek Kumar wrote: > > In some devices difference in chip-id should be enough to pick > the right BDF. Add another support for chip-id based BDF selection. > With this new option, ath10k supports 2 fallback options. > > The board name with chip-id as option looks as follows > board name 'bus=snoc,qmi-board-id=ff,qmi-chip-id=320' > > Tested-on: WCN3990 hw1.0 SNOC WLAN.HL.3.2.2-00696-QCAHLSWMTPL-1 > Tested-on: QCA6174 HW3.2 WLAN.RM.4.4.1-00157-QCARMSWPZ-1 > Signed-off-by: Abhishek Kumar > --- > > Changes in v3: > - Resurreted Patch V1 because as per discussion we do need two > fallback board names and refactored ath10k_core_create_board_name. > > drivers/net/wireless/ath/ath10k/core.c | 41 +++++++++++++++++++------- > 1 file changed, 30 insertions(+), 11 deletions(-) Reviewed-by: Douglas Anderson